11.01 — Denomination of Import Authorisation/Licence/ Certificate/ Permissions
-
(a) CIF value of Authorisation / FOB value of export obligation shall be indicated both in Rupees and in freely convertible currency(s) at the exchange rate(s) prevailing on Authorisation issue date.
-
(b) Remittance of foreign exchange and discharge of export obligation against Authorisation shall be regulated in freely convertible currency or in Indian Rupees as per para 2.52 and 2.53 of FTP.
-
(c) No enhancement in Rupee value shall be necessary if remittance of foreign exchange is covered by CIF value of Authorisation shown in freely convertible currency.
-
(d) However, on Advance Authorisation(s), issued for exports to ACU countries, export obligation shall be denominated and discharged in ACU dollars.
-
(e) Export obligation in Advance Authorisation for intermediate supply and for deemed export, where supplies are to be made within the country, shall be denominated and discharged in Indian rupees.
